What rfp software tools for accounting and tax do and why they matter

RFP software tools for accounting and tax centralize the process of requesting, receiving, and evaluating proposals for services and software related to financial reporting, tax compliance, and advisory work. These tools combine document management, workflow routing, and eSignature capabilities so teams can standardize vendor selection, preserve audit trails, and meet regulatory recordkeeping. For U.S. accounting and tax operations they reduce manual steps, improve version control, and support legal validity under ESIGN and UETA when paired with compliant eSignature providers such as signNow (Recommended).

Feature set to evaluate for accounting and tax RFPs

Assess features that directly support secure proposal collection, compliance evidence, and team coordination to ensure procurement and tax requirements are met.

eSignature

Legally compliant electronic signing with audit logs, signer authentication options, and tamper-evident seals to help meet ESIGN and UETA requirements for vendor agreements and engagement letters.

Templates

Reusable RFP and questionnaire templates that include conditional logic, scoring fields, and required compliance questions to reduce customization time for each procurement.

Bulk Send

Ability to distribute the same RFP or NDA to many vendors simultaneously while tracking individual responses and signatures to speed large-scale solicitations.

Audit Trail

Comprehensive event history showing access, edits, and signature timestamps to support internal reviews and external audits related to vendor selection.

API

RESTful API and webhooks for integrating RFP data with invoicing, ERP, or case management systems to automate post-award workflows and record updates.

Access Controls

Granular role assignments, domain restrictions, and conditional permissions to limit exposure of sensitive tax and financial information during the RFP process.

Best practices for secure and reliable RFP processes

Follow consistent procedures to reduce risk, simplify audits, and speed vendor selection when using rfp software tools for accounting and tax.

Maintain centralized, versioned RFP templates
Store master templates in a controlled library with clear naming, version history, and approval gates so every RFP includes required compliance questions and consistent scoring criteria, reducing review time and errors.
Restrict access and use role-based approvals
Limit editing and distribution rights to authorized personnel, require designated approvers for contract terms, and log every change to satisfy audit and compliance reviews while reducing accidental disclosures.
Include compliance and security checkpoints
Embed questions about SOC reports, data handling, and HIPAA or FERPA considerations where applicable; require vendors to submit evidence and contact points for security reviews during evaluation.
Preserve a complete audit trail
Automatically retain logs of distribution, receipt, signing events, and reviewer comments so teams can demonstrate chain-of-custody and decision rationale during audits or regulatory inquiries.

Retention and backup considerations for RFP records

Document retention policies should align with tax and financial recordkeeping requirements and internal governance for vendor selection artifacts.

IRS Retention Guidelines for Tax Records:

Retain supporting documents for at least three to seven years.

Contract and procurement retention policy:

Keep awarded contract files for the contract term plus retention period.

Audit evidence preservation schedule:

Archive RFP files until the statute of limitations and audit windows close.

Backup and disaster recovery cadence:

Daily backups with periodic integrity checks.

Document disposal and sanitization process:

Secure deletion according to policy when retention expires.
